Woman falls off train, guard's effort to save her fails

Tiruchirapalli, Jun 15 (UNI) The efforts of an alert guard and other passengers in the Tiruchirapalli-Chennai Pallavan superfast express train to save the life of a 30 year-old woman passenger, who was found lying on the adjacent track, proved futile here today.

Railway sources said, the guard, who noticed the woman, immediately informed the engine driver, who stopped the train. The guard and other passengers then handed over the injured woman to the station authorities here.

However, when she was rushed to government hospital, she succumbed to her injuries.

The station authorities discovered that the woman, hailing from Alampatti, and travelling by Chennai-Kumbakkonam Rockfort express with a valid ticket, had slipped and fallen on the tracks.

Railway police have registered a case and were investigating.
